Kongjun Binguan (zhaodaisuo): Not in the guidebooks
Another one worth trying would be Kongjun Binguan (zhaodaisuo), near the "back route" of Taishan, quite close to the summit. I haven't seen this hotel mentioned in guidebooks so I think it's worth listing. Rooms seem to be pretty cheap as well, about 100 RMB/night.

Guanri Binguan & Bayi Binguan: Best Sunrise View Hotels on Taishan
The best hotels for sunrise viewing would be Guanri Binguan and Bayi Binguan. These 2 unmissable hotels are next to each other at Guanri peak which's the best spot for watching sunrise. If you get a good room, you can watch the sunrise from the comfort of your room. We didn't stay there but I was quoted about 200 RMB for twin with ensuite at Guanri Binguan.
Best sunrise views on Taishan.

Mountain Radio Hotel (Diantai Binguan): Unique "Landmark" for Hotel
Mountain Radio Hotel aka Diantai Binguan was where we stayed. It has a fab location near Yuhuang Temple (highest point of Taishan).
There're different kinds of rooms, twins with ensuite for 160 or 120 RMB and twins without bathing facilities for 80 RMB. We stayed on a Friday night and bargained the 160 RMB room to 120 RMB. The rooms are clean and have TV but no aircon. Check that the TV reception works, I was specifically looking for Hunan TV and tried 3 TVs in various rooms before settling on one.
Bring pliers if you want unlimited hot water for shower. ;)
There's a cafeteria of sorts on-site but we didn't eat there.
Not sure if they've English speakers either.
Pretty decent sunrise view. 5-10 mins walk to sunrise viewing vantage point.
Very easy to spot and recognise as there're huge satellite dishes in the compound!

Nantienmen hotel: Top of the mountain accomodation
This hotel is one of teh first you see when you arrive, exhausted, through the south gate to heaven at the top of Tai Shan.
Room rates came down rapidly from 460 to 200 Yuan on negotiation.
The rooms are pretty horrid. The bathroom was filthy and the cleanliness of the sheets was dubious. Also the hotel was very noisy. Unfortunately this is par for the course on Tai Shan as there are quite a lot of people who want to stay there.
The hotel staff come and bang on your door early in the morning so that you can go and watch the sunrise.
Views from the room I had were outstanding which almost made up for the total lack of comfort.
